In 1994 he founded Brad Mehldau Trio, with bassist Larry Grenadier and drummer Jorge Rossy; in 2005, Jeff Ballard replaced Rossy. Brad Mehldau started playing piano at the age of six, and has released more than ten albums.

The lyrics to Brad Mehldau's song "Secret Love" explore the theme of love that is hidden and eventually exposed. The song starts with the admission of a secret love that the singer has been harboring inside themselves for some time. This kind of love is often kept to oneself for fear of rejection, but as the song progresses, the singer's love becomes too strong to hide.
The second stanza reveals that the singer has confided in a friendly star about their love for the other person. By telling the star about their feelings, the singer is expressing a universal truth about the way that people often share their deepest desires and secrets with inanimate objects like the stars. The singer also explains how wonderful their love interest is and why they are in love with them.
Finally, the third stanza shows how the singer's secret love is no longer a secret, and they have proclaimed it to the world. They shout it from the highest hills and even tell the golden daffodils, symbolizing nature's understanding and acceptance of their love. The singer expresses relief in being able to freely express their love without fear of rejection or judgment.
Overall, the lyrics to "Secret Love" reveal the power of love to overcome fear and the importance of being true to oneself and one's feelings.
